Mary Todd Obituary

Mary Herndon Davis Todd LAURENS - Mary Herndon Davis Todd died peacefully on Friday, February 17, 2017, at her home on West Main Street in Laurens, surrounded by her family. She was born in Laurens, SC, a daughter of the late James Robert and Mary Hammond Sullivan Davis. She was a graduate of Winthrop College, where she was Maid of Honor in May Court. After college, she worked for the FBI in Charlotte, NC, under J. Edgar Hoover. In 1943, she married Lt. Cmdr. Edward R. Holt of Charlotte, NC. Lt. Cmdr. Holt was the commander of the USS Bullhead, and his submarine was the last submarine loss of World War II. After Cmdr. Holt's death, she moved to 8 East 68th Street in New York City. She worked as an interior designer for Earnshaw Interiors on Madison Avenue. She continued her career in New York City working for NBC Studios in the early days of television. In the summer of 1948, while visiting her parents in Laurens, she met James C. Todd Jr., a former University of Georgia football star, who had returned to Laurens after World War II to join his father and brother in their wholesale grocery business. They were married on October 12, 1948, and lived happily in Laurens raising their two sons, James C. Todd III and Robert H. Todd. After her husband's death in 1994, and having a love of travel, she opened The Uptown Collection Antiques on the Laurens Square. She made numerous trips to Europe in search of antiques for her shop. She had an adventurous and full life, but always had a sincere love for her fellow man and those in need. She was a lifelong member of First Presbyterian Church, where she was a former president of the Women of the Church, Sunday school teacher, and honorary Life Member of Presbyterian Women.
